The classic Macy's Thanksgiving Day Parade has been watched by millions of New York residents and millions more on television.

Broadway will be showcased with performances from musicals “Six,” “Moulin Rouge!” and “Wicked,” as well as a sneak preview of NBC’s “Annie Live!” and the Radio City Rockettes.
